When is the best time of year to stay in a hostel in Ballybofey?
Good weather’s definitely a plus when you’re discovering new places, so here are some stats that might be helpful: The hottest months are usually July and August with an average temp of 56°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 41°F. Average annual precipitation for Ballybofey is 47 inches.
What is there to see and do in Ballybofey?
Depending on your interests, you might like to check out these things around Ballybofey. Get out into nature with places like Bluestack Mountains, Oakfield Park, and Letterkenny Town Park. Cultural attractions include The Balor Theatre, Balor Arts Centre, and Donegal County Museum. Visit landmarks like Glenmore Estate.
What's the best way to get to and around Ballybofey while staying at a hostel?
Keep this information about transit options in Ballybofey in your back pocket to make the most of your stay: You can fly into the closest airport, which is Letterkenny (LTR-Letterkenny Airfield), located 11.7 mi (18.9 km) away from the city center. Another option is Donegal (CFN), which is 27.6 mi (44.5 km) away.
